Nov. 18, 2008: MCAA Recognized for Green Initiatives
ROCKVILLE, Md. - The Mechanical Contractors Association of America (MCAA) was honored for its green initiatives over the last year with a Green Leadership Award. Bisnow on Business, the publisher of a Washington, D.C.-based electronic business newsletter, the U.S. Green Building Council, and George Washington University selected the award winners from over 100 submissions.
MCAA was recognized for launching GreenContractors.us, a website that provides green building information to members; funding two sustainability research studies; and developing the Mechanical Service Contractors Association (MSCA) GreenStar designation for companies that have shown an exceptional commitment to sustainable mechanical service. MCAA and other award recipients were honored at a special event in Rockville, Md.
